When is the best time of year to stay in a hostel in Hita?
The weather is important when you want to venture out and explore, so here’s a little information that might be helpful: The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 75°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 44°F. The rainiest months in Hita are June, July, August, and September, with each month seeing an average of 11 inches of rainfall.
What is there to see and do in Hita?
Depending on how you want to spend your time, you might appreciate these things around Hita. Get out into nature with places like Aso Kuju National Park, Kizan Park, and Tsukikuma Park. Cultural attractions include Hita Gion Museum, Hirose Museum, and Bungo Mori Roundhouse. Visit landmarks like Kangien.
What's the best way to get to and around Hita while staying at a hostel?
Keep this information about transit options in Hita in your back pocket to make the most of your stay: You can search for flights to the closest airport, which is Kumamoto Airport (KMJ), located 28.8 mi (46.4 km) from the city center. An alternative is Fukuoka Airport (FUK), situated 37.5 mi (60.4 km) away. Once you’ve arrived, you might want to use public transit to get around. If you’re hoping to explore more of the area, make your way to Amagase Station to catch a train.
